This big boy is a sweetheart that
we have named Bubba, because he is a big, lovable, goofy 'Bubba'
kind of boy...
German Shepherd Rescue received a
call from a local animal shelter about a very special dog who was
out of time. In fact, he was actually about to get the "go to
sleep" needle when a shelter worker watched him wag his tail and
kiss the hand of his about-to-be- executioner. At that point, we
got a call from the shelter begging us to save this sweet and
loving boy.
Our volunteer dropped everything
and was on her way... When she arrived at the shelter, she found
one of the most loving and well tempered dogs she had ever seen.
When she approached the cage where he was waiting with two other
male dogs, it became evident that he is a total sweetie-pie!!!
This big burly German Shepherd is a big love bug. Most
times, dogs in the shelter will try to block the other dogs from
the person visiting. Bubba was running and nudging his roommates
as if the say "Come on, she's looking at us!!! Get up here
and smile". He's such a good natured boy.
Bubba is a VERY impressive boy.
He is HUGE!!! When going for a walk, people step off the curb to
go around him. What they don't understand is Bubba is a TOTAL
LOVER BOY!!! He will be about 120 pounds when he gains some much
needed weight. While he will protect his people, he has an
excellent temperament. He is good with other dogs and ADORES
people of all sizes. He made fast friends with two boys, ages 4
and 6. Bubba will make some family very happy.
Bubba is approximately 18 to 24
months old. He is HUGE so we thought he was a little older.
After being examined by our Vet, we discovered he is younger than
we thought. Poor Bubba was most likely kept chained in a filthy
yard, because part of his ears have been eaten away by flies.
Whatever pain and neglect he has suffered at the hands of humans
has not damped his spirit or his love for people. He loves to
give you his paw and he's also a "talker". He will take a much
coveted treat from you as gentle as a lamb.
Bubba is a perfect gentleman on
leash and keeps a close eye on his people. He greets everyone
(human and fur-friends) with a wag of his tail and a friendly
kiss. Bubba is good with kids, dogs (both large and small), and
with his gentle disposition we think he would also be just fine
with cats. If you are looking for an all-around wonderful
boy, Bubba's the one!!!
